A team of undergraduate students of the riders ranked third in the competition of the National Small Business Institute Consulting Project of the Year of this year.
Created in 1976, the Small Business Institute (SBI) offers students the possibility of consulting small businesses and non -profit organizations, helping real organizations to study potential opportunities or to seek a problem and recommend a solution. Rider has proven itself of success with SBI, finishing in the top 10 more than 40 times, including six national champions, since the university began to participate in the project of the year project in 1998.
